Fresh rockslide blocks Manali-Leh highway again

MANALI: Vehicular movement was hit on the Manali-Leh highway (NH-03) on Thursday after a massive rockslide blocked it on Wednesday night. With huge boulders sitting on the road, leading to massive traffic jam on either side, officials began diverting light vehicles to Manali-Palchan bypass road while heavy vehicles were made to wait for clearing of the debris.

A Border Roads Organisation (BRO) official said, “One of the boulders is really huge. We are working on breaking it into pieces by drilling and blasting. We have deployed adequate number of jawans and machines and hope to restore the traffic by night.”

This particular area near Nehru Kund, about 7km from Manali, is prone to landslides and avalanches. It has witnessed many landslides in the past. After a brief halt in sliding in the area over the past few months, the recent heavy rainfall has activated it (sliding) again.
